3. Popularity

The popularity of terms utilized by grooming establishments on visual social media platforms directly correlates with content visibility. Terms with high usage frequency are more likely to surface in search results and platform exploration features. This increased visibility can generate a greater influx of impressions and engagement, thereby expanding reach. For example, a widely-used term such as #barberlife, with millions of associated posts, inherently provides more opportunities for content to be discovered compared to a niche term with limited usage. This effect underlines the importance of assessing the popularity of terms during strategy development.

However, reliance solely on prevalent terms may lead to content being buried within a saturated landscape. The high volume of content associated with broad keywords can result in lower organic reach, diminishing the intended impact. Therefore, a balanced approach incorporating a mix of high-popularity terms and more specific, lower-volume terms is often more effective. One strategy involves identifying terms related to current trends in men’s grooming, such as a particular haircut style gaining traction, and leveraging their popularity to highlight relevant services.

In conclusion, while popularity is a significant factor in boosting content visibility, strategic employment is essential. The optimal approach involves a calculated blend of high-volume terms and targeted, less common keywords. This method ensures both broad exposure and the ability to connect with a more defined audience, maximizing the effectiveness of a grooming establishment’s social media strategy. The ongoing monitoring of trend data and term usage metrics is imperative for continuous refinement and adaptation.

5. Location

Geographic specificity is paramount within a visual content strategy for grooming establishments. The incorporation of location-based keywords refines targeting and increases the likelihood of connecting with local clientele, which is critical for brick-and-mortar businesses.

  • City and Neighborhood Tagging

    Precise identification of a city and its specific neighborhoods allows potential customers within a defined area to discover relevant content. The use of #[City]barber or #[Neighborhood]barbershop targets individuals actively seeking services in a specific geographic region. For example, a barbershop in Brooklyn might employ #Brooklynbarber and #Williamsburgbarber to attract local clients. This strategy enhances visibility within a community.

  • Landmark Association

    Associating terms with local landmarks or points of interest further refines targeting. Utilizing #[Landmark]barber or #[LocalAttraction]haircut helps users seeking services near well-known locations to easily find relevant establishments. A shop near Central Park could use #CentralParkBarber, maximizing exposure to those visiting or residing near the landmark.

  • Event-Driven Targeting

    Leveraging local events or festivals presents an opportunity to attract a transient audience. Employing #[CityEvent]haircut or #[FestivalName]grooming can capture individuals seeking grooming services in connection with a specific local event. For instance, a barbershop near a music festival might use #MusicFestHaircut to attract attendees seeking a quick trim.

  • Geotagging Integration

    Beyond keyword incorporation, direct geotagging of posts on visual social media platforms is critical. This feature allows users to discover content based on proximity, increasing the chances of local residents finding a nearby barbershop. Consistent geotagging reinforces location relevance and drives foot traffic.

These facets, when strategically applied, ensure that location becomes a powerful tool in directing local customers to grooming establishments. Integrating these tactics enhances the efficacy of content, fostering business growth within a defined geographic area.

7. Combination

The judicious amalgamation of distinct keyword types is critical for optimizing content related to barbering services on visual social platforms. The efficacy of “#barberhashtagsforinstagram” hinges on strategic combination. Individual categories, such as relevance or popularity, provide only a partial benefit. The interaction between these categories amplifies discoverability. For instance, combining a relevant term like #fadehaircut with a location-based term like #[City]barber generates a refined search result that directly targets a local clientele interested in specific services. This synergistic effect demonstrates the importance of a multifaceted strategy.

Consider a scenario where a barbershop promotes a new hair product. A simplistic approach might involve using only #[ProductName]. A more effective approach would combine the product name with service-related terms (e.g., #[ProductName]styling), style-related terms (e.g., #pompadour with #[ProductName]), and location-specific terms (e.g., #[City]barber #[ProductName]). This layered strategy addresses multiple search intents, increasing the likelihood of connecting with diverse segments of potential customers. Additionally, the inclusion of a trending term, if applicable, further enhances visibility.

The challenge lies in achieving a balance. Overuse of terms, even in combination, can result in a cluttered or spam-like appearance, potentially harming credibility and organic reach. The key insight is that purposeful and contextually appropriate term aggregation, guided by an understanding of search algorithms and user behavior, is essential for effective social media marketing in the grooming industry. The optimal strategy is not simply about quantity but about the strategic integration of complementary terms.

Frequently Asked Questions

The following addresses common inquiries and clarifies uncertainties regarding the strategic utilization of terms relevant to grooming establishments on a prominent visual platform.

Question 1: What is the optimal number of terms to include in a single post?

While platform algorithms permit a substantial quantity, the inclusion of an excessive number can diminish credibility and organic reach. A judicious selection, typically ranging from three to seven highly relevant and targeted terms, is generally recommended to maintain clarity and authenticity.

Question 2: How frequently should terms be updated to reflect trending styles or services?

Periodic review and adaptation are essential. A monthly assessment of trend data and performance metrics allows for necessary adjustments, ensuring that keyword strategies remain aligned with current preferences and search behaviors. More frequent evaluation may be warranted during periods of rapid stylistic change.

Question 3: Is it advantageous to utilize automated term generation tools?

Automated tools can provide suggestions but often lack the nuance and context necessary for optimal performance. Human oversight is crucial to ensure that selected terms are relevant, brand-aligned, and appropriately targeted. Blind reliance on automated systems may result in diminished engagement and diluted brand messaging.

Question 4: How can the success of a specific phrase be accurately measured?

Success can be quantitatively measured through platform analytics, tracking impressions, reach, engagement rates (likes, comments, shares), and website traffic originating from social media. Qualitative assessment involves monitoring comments and direct messages for sentiment analysis and gauging customer feedback.

Question 5: What role do less popular, niche terms play in a comprehensive strategy?

Niche terms, while generating less overall traffic, can attract a highly targeted audience actively seeking specific services or styles. These terms are particularly valuable for differentiating specialized offerings and connecting with discerning clientele. They complement broader, high-volume terms, creating a balanced approach.

Question 6: Should the same set of phrases be used across all posts, or should they vary?

Repetition of identical phrases across all posts can be perceived as monotonous and may negatively impact reach. Varied terminology, tailored to the specific content and intended audience of each post, is recommended to maintain engagement and optimize discoverability. Flexibility and adaptation are key.
